THE FA have launched a brand new tournament with several former England stars fronting a star-studded line-up.
All eyes will be on Wembley next month when Manchester City and Crystal Palace battle it out for the FA Cup.


But ahead of the crunch final, the FA and tournament sponsors Emirates have launched a brand new five-a-side football tournament.
Featuring four teams, the competition will take place at St George’s Park — the base of the FA and England’s football teams.
The teams will be made up of non-league stars, influencers and local community heroes.
But there are a slew of former aces involved, with each heading up a side.
57-time England striker and Tottenham icon Jermain Defoe will front one side.
While another will be led by eight-time England goalie Ben Foster.
Chelsea title winner Shaun Wright-Phillips will take charge of the third team.
While Newcastle hero Shola Ameobi is the fourth name getting involved.

Each side will represent an Emirates Flight Hub.
These include London, Birmingham, Manchester and Newcastle.


Each one is also linked with a destination such as Indonesia, Dubai, Thailand and Cambodia.
And the tournament’s top scorer and best player could end up being gifted a flight to their team’s corresponding country as a reward.
A date for the competition is yet to be confirmed, but it will be streamed live on YouTube.
